Team Swampert (M) @ Leftovers Ability: Torrent EVs: 240 HP/216 Def/52 SAtk Relaxed nature (+Def, -Spd) - Earthquake - Ice Beam - Protect - Stealth Rock I love Swapert for the fact that he always is able to get up stealth rock early game unless he taunt in which i may have to wait later. In addition he is very bulky so he takes hit very well. And he adds a eletricity immunity to my team which i needed. --- Zapdos @ Leftovers Bold Nature Ability Pressure EVs 252HP\ 222 Def\ 36 Spd Bold Nature -Roar -Thunderbolt -Hidden Power (ice) -Roost Zapdos is a great pokemon but can be hinder by Stealth Rock. But he is check for fightrer pokemon and the ever so popular scizor. I use roar for schuffling through my oppenent team and adding up stealth rock damage. He also a check for bulky waters . --- Scizor (M) @ Choice Band Ability: Technician EVs: 252 Atk/4 Def/252 Spd Adamant nature (+Atk, -SAtk) - Bullet Punch -U turn - Superpower - Pursuit Scizor is fuckin amazing with the attack bullet punch. He is so great with a choice band being able to revenge kill things with bullet punch. u turn is for scouting for counters. Superpower is just raw power lol. I never really use pursit but it can help with latios i guess. --- Vaporean (M) @ Leftovers Ability: Water Absorb EVs: 188 HP/ /252 Def/ 68Spd Bold nature (+Def, -Atk) - Surf - Hidden Power (electric) - wish - protect Vaporean is my favorite bulky water pokemon just for the fact that it can wish which add survivability to my team. He a check for infernape which people still use for some reason lol. But he also a secondary Gyardos counter. --- Tyranitar (M) @ Choice Band Ability: Sand Stream EVs: 252 HP/40 Atk/216 Sp def Careful nature ( Sp Def , -SAtk) - Stone Edge - Pursuit - Crunch - Earthquake Tyranitar have an amazing movepool but it sets up a Sandstorm which fucks over those damn focus sashes and rain dance team. I decided to go with a more Special defensive Tyranitar instead of a speedy one. Its speed isn't that great to start off with so. But he a check for all psychics. He can take many supper effetive attacks because of his bulkyness --- Salmence @ Life Orb Ability: Intimidate EVs: 80 Atk/252 Sp Atk Def/ 176 Spd Rash nature (+Sp Atk, -Sp Def) - Fire Blast - Roost - Draco Meteor - Brick Break --- This thing is a great wall breaker because Draco meteor wrecks anything that doesnt resist. Fire Blast is needed because metagross and bronzorg are still popular. Brick Break is for Tyranitar and BLissey which i dont see much of. Roost is for survivability.

Hardly anybody was using that Swampert set, but its been seeing a LOT more use since my team. Suspicious >_>
This seems like a solid team, IMO. I'm honestly against CB Scizor, as the Life Orb Swords Dance set works so much better on so many levels, but I can see how some people might like it. I think you may have issues with MixApe, but a lot of teams do, honestly. Vaporeon can take it on pretty nicely, anyway. Frankly you're Salamence set isn't all that great. Brick Break doesn't OHKO the regular Blissey anyway, and on that turn they can cripple you or start healing. Dragonite can fullfil the type of set you want much better, with overall better defenses and nearly just as good attack, and he can use Superpower which is a guarenteed KO on Blissey. |
